Road User Payment Scheme Update

From: Cabinet - Thursday, 18th December, 2025 2.00 pm - December 18, 2025

...to note the conclusions of the business case and option development work for the Road User Payment Scheme, to anticipate a further report on the Outline Business Case recommendations, and to support a more detailed assessment of lower impact options like a Workplace Parking Levy.
